Age: 7-9 years old 50 minutes per class 2 days per week This ongoing, full-year class blends reading, writing, spelling, grammar, and math into interactive lessons that help learners grow in both skills and confidence. Families can join anytime, and each week stands on its own, making it easy to fit learning into your homeschool routine. In language arts, students explore stories, poems, nonfiction, biographies, and more while building strong reading comprehension and fluency. Writing comes to life through fun and meaningful projects like narratives, opinion pieces, poetry, letters, and creative prompts that encourage kids to share their ideas. Along the way, we strengthen grammar, sentence structure, vocabulary, and spelling with weekly practice that supports lasting mastery. In math, learners develop solid number sense and problem-solving skills through hands-on practice with addition and subtraction within 1,000, multiplication and division strategies, fractions, measurement, time, area and perimeter, graphs, and real-world word problems. We focus on helping students understand the “why” behind math so they feel confident tackling new challenges. Each week includes spelling lists, guided lessons, games, discussion, and optional practice at home.
